Output 7580efdb39d21745e683d23f190a56505162e5248dff1202913f93a6b22ccd0b:0

value
149317778
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e3892007fd7abfdf8c5629cdcacebe73a5587a4e OP_EQUALVERIFY OP_CHECKSIG
address
1Mk6fAdStqap7aHL6XrerVNLVt3WY4aQC5
transaction
7580efdb39d21745e683d23f190a56505162e5248dff1202913f93a6b22ccd0b
spent
true